Financial and Project Management by the Sample Clauses

Financial and Project Management by the. Candidate Country The programme will be managed in accordance with the Phare Extended Decentralised Implementation System (EDIS) procedures as set down in the EDIS Accreditation Decision and the Agreement on the Implementation of EDIS (EDIS Implementation Agreement; EIA) concluded between each of the Partner Countries and the Commission2. Extended Decentralisation will, however, apply from the date of accession at the latest. The National Aid Co-ordinator (NAC) will have overall responsibility for programming and monitoring of Phare programmes. The National Authorising Officer (NAO) and the Project Authorising Officers (PAO) will ensure that the programmes are implemented in line with the procedures laid down in the EDIS Implementation Agreement and/or the DIS Manual as well as the other instructions of the Commission, and that all contracts required to implement the Financing Memorandum are awarded using the procedures and standard documents defined and most recently published by the European Commission for the implementation of External Actions. The NAC and the NAO shall be jointly responsible for co-ordination between Phare (including Phare CBC), ISPA and SAPARD as well as the Structural and Cohesion Funds. The National Fund (NF) in the Ministry of Finance, headed by the NAO, will supervise the financial management of the Programme, and will be responsible for reporting to the European Commission. The NAO shall have overall responsibility for financial management of the Phare funds. He shall ensure that the Phare rules, regulations and procedures pertaining to procurement, reporting and financial management as well as Community state aid rules are respected, and that a reporting and project information system is functioning. This includes the responsibility of reporting all suspected and actual cases of fraud and irregularity. The NAO shall have the full overall accountability for the Phare funds of a programme until the closure of the programme.

  • Subrecipient’s Project Manager and Key Personnel Subrecipient shall appoint a Project Manager to direct the Subrecipient’s efforts in fulfilling Subrecipient’s obligations under this Contract. This Project Manager shall be subject to approval by the County and shall not be changed without the written consent of the County’s Project Manager,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ld. The Subrecipient’s Project Manager, in consultation and agreement with County, shall be assigned to this project for the duration of the Contract and shall diligently pursue all work and services to meet the project time lines. The County’s Project Manager shall have the right to require the removal and replacement of the Subrecipient’s Project Manager from providing services to the County under this Contract. The County’s Project Manager shall notify the Subrecipient in writing of such action. The Subrecipient shall accomplish the removal within five (5) business days after written notice by the County’s Project Manager. The County’s Project Manager shall review and approve the appointment of the replacement for the Subrecipient’s Project Manager.   • Construction Management Landlord or its Affiliate or agent shall supervise the Work, make disbursements required to be made to the contractor, and act as a liaison between the contractor and Tenant and coordinate the relationship between the Work, the Building and the Building’s Systems. In consideration for Landlord’s construction supervision services, Tenant shall pay to Landlord a construction supervision fee equal to three percent (3%) of Tenant’s Costs specified in Section 7.
